Solar energy is a renewable source of energy, thus, it doesn’t pollute the environment as the other electricity sources do. It doesn’t leave harmful chemicals in the atmosphere like carbon. The things I’m about to tell you here might sound a little trivial but I hope this will make you realize how powerful the sun is and the energy it gives:

*Do you know that apart from an electricity source with the aid of solar panels, you can also use solar to heat your water and air at home? the dynamics of how it works may be a little different with that of solar but both of them can work together in harmony.

*Another kind of solar involves the process of letting the sunlight enter the house through the windows so that it may warm up your house. This process, otherwise called passive solar, requires the doors to be closed all the time. Along the process, it also provides light and saves you on electricity.
